Cabinet of Saint Neots
The cabinet of Saint Neots is the principal executive organ of the government, tasked with advising the prime minister and implementing government policies. The cabinet is composed of ministers appointed by the president on the advice of the prime minister. These ministers oversee specific areas of governance such as finance, education, health, defence, and foreign affairs. While ministers are often MPs, it is not a strict requirement. The cabinet is collectively accountable to Parliament and works within the framework of parliamentary democracy to ensure the laws passed by Parliament are enforced. The cabinet operates under the leadership of the prime minister and is essential in shaping and enacting government policy and agenda. The Rhodes cabinet was formed on 29 May 2022 after the 15 May 2022 general election. It is a coalition government led by the Progressive Party and consisting of the All-Regions Party and the Green Alliance. It is led by Prime Minister Matthew Rhodes, Progressive leader. The coalition has a majority of 6 seats in the Parliament of Saint Neots to the combined opposition party seats.
